Artist
Sean Paul
Brought dancehall to global pop dominance in the 2000s with "Get Busy" and "Temperature," creating a more melodic, radio-friendly version of the genre that topped international charts. His 2002 album "Dutty Rock" featured "Get Busy," the first dancehall single to reach number one on the Billboard Hot 100, proving dancehall's mainstream commercial viability.
